Tier 3 has not yet been implemented, and there is currently no information to show when it will be introduced. It was designed to replace the Seasonal Agricultural Workers Scheme (SAWS) and the Sector Based Scheme (SBS).

The agricultural industry and the catering industry were the main beneficiaries of the above schemes, with a supply of workers allowed entry for a limited period of time to take vacancies that could not be filled from the resident workforce. Unlike most other employment based categories, these positions did not permit the dependants of workers to come to the UK, and there was no possibility of switching to any other category.
